Development of Discrete Element Code Considering the Characteristics of Clay
Macro mechanical properties of clayey soil are closely related to its microstructure
and discrete element method is an important tool to study the macro-micro link of mechanical behavior of geo-material.However
the majority of the present discrete element software package are developed for non-cohesive granular soil
and discrete element code applicable to clayey soil is rare.In this paper
we present a discrete element code for clayey soil which has taken account of the platy shape of clay particle and complicate physical-chemical interaction between clay particles.Especially
this paper highlights the collision detection and the calculation of double layer repulsive force
Van der Waals attractive force and Born repulsive force between clay particles.Finally
a simple application of the present discrete element code is given to validate its rationality preliminarily.
